Vanillaware Unveils Grand Knights History

The developer of the Wii platform, Muramasa: The Demon's Blade, and the game for the PlayStation 2, Odin Sphere, announced the company's next project, RPG for the PlayStation Portable called Grand Knights History. According to Japan's Famitsu magazine (translation by 1Up), History Grand Knights will be a turn-based role-playing game set in the land of Ristia.

The player will control a knight belonging to one of three factions vie Ristia: appearance and stats of the party will be personalized. "The characters are animated like in the 2D action games and are trying to build a new type of gameplay merging online and offline," said project director Tomohiko Deguchi.

"All the players will fight in the same world." Marvelous Entertainment will be the publisher of the game will arrive this summer in Japan. Yet to announce plans for the company's launch of the game in the West.
